Our EMT course, Fire Tech 96 (EMT) covers the didactic education, clinical experience in an ambulance, (two 10-hour observational ride-a-longs with a minimum of ten patient contacts) and skill development of pre-hospital concepts, theories and practices required of the Emergency Medical Technician. The EMT course includes 135 hours of classroom / hybrid instruction as well as 81 hours of lab instruction, including field and clinical internship. The program includes instruction in basic life support, such as cardiopulmonary resuscitation, automatic external defibrillator use, patient physical assessment, bandaging and splinting, traction splinting, spinal immobilization, airway management, medication administration, oxygen therapy and other noninvasive procedures.
